Lovari

A Vlax Romani variety with strong Hungarian and Slavic influence. Spoken across Central Europe.

Sinte Manouche

Sinti · Manush · Sinté

A northwestern Romanes variety spoken by Sinti and Manouche communities across Germany, France, the Benelux, and northern Italy. Shaped by long contact with Germanic and Romance languages.
